In this YouTUBE video, you can see Elliott Isenberg refusing his diploma that the President of Amherst College was trying to hand to him. Before Elliott walked past the President of Amherst, he took a glance at a man on the podium named Robert McNamara — the Secretary of Defense for Lyndon Baines Johnson — who was prosecuting the War in Vietnam.

You can also see 19 graduates (including Elliott) walk out of their graduation ceremony when Robert McNamara name is mentioned as the recipient of an honorary Master’s Degree. After the walkout, the remainder of the guests break out into a standing ovation.

This took place on the 3rd of June in 1966.
